gond         
n. hinge, movable joint on which a door or other part turns
enlever de ses gonds      
unhinge
sortir de ses gonds      
lose one's temper, fail to maintain one's composure, lose one's self-control

Definition

Gond
[g?nd, g??nd]
(also Gondi 'g?ndi)
¦ noun (plural same)
1. a member of an indigenous people living in the hill forests of central India.
2. the Dravidian language of the Gond.
Origin
from Sanskrit go??a.

Gond

Gond may refer to:

  • Gondi people of central India
  • Gondi language, the language of the Gondi people
  • Gond (raga), a musical composition in the Sikh tradition
  • Gond (Forgotten Realms), a fictional deity in the Forgotten Realms campaign setting of the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.
  • Gonds, a race in The Krotons, a serial in the television series Doctor Who
